What is an interventional radiology travel?

An Interventional Radiology Travel job involves working as a specialized radiology professional who temporarily fills staffing needs at various healthcare facilities across different locations. These professionals perform minimally invasive, image-guided procedures to diagnose and treat a range of conditions. Travel roles typically require adaptability, strong clinical skills, and the ability to quickly integrate into new healthcare teams. Assignments can last several weeks to months, offering opportunities for career growth, higher pay, and travel exper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an interventional radiology travel nurse,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Interventional Radiology Travel Nurse, you need a registered nursing license, strong knowledge of radiologic procedures, and experience in critical care or interventional radiology settings. Familiarity with imaging equipment, electronic health records, and certifications such as BLS, ACLS, and sometimes CRN are typically required. Exceptional communication, adaptability, and problem-solving skills help you work effectively in diverse clinical environments and with multidisciplinary teams. These skills and qualifications are crucial for ensuring patient safety and delivering efficient, high-quality care while adapting to new healthcare facilities.

What are some unique challenges faced by interventional radiology travel professionals compared to permanent staff?

Interventional Radiology Travel professionals often face the challenge of quickly adapting to new hospital protocols, technologies, and team dynamics with each assignment. They must be highly flexible and proactive in learning the workflow and building rapport with staff in unfamiliar environments. This role also requires strong communication skills to ensure patient safety and procedural efficiency despite frequent transitions. However, travel positions offer valuable opportunities to gain diverse experience and expand professional networks.
